Dosage and strength
Tadalafil is available in multiple strengths: 2.5mg, 5mg, 10mg, and the recommended 20mg tablets. Each strength caters to different severity levels of erectile dysfunction and your doctor's assessment.
Dose for erectile dysfunction
For treating erectile dysfunction, the advised starting dose of tadalafil is 10mg, taken as needed. Remember, do not exceed one tablet per day to maintain safety and efficacy.
Your doctor may adjust your dosage based on individual response to the medication and your overall health condition. Regular check-ins with your healthcare provider can help guide these decisions.
It's crucial to remember that the effects of tadalafil can last for over 24 hours; thus, a 10mg or 20mg dosage is not intended for daily use. Consistent overuse can lead to diminished effectiveness and possible side effects.
For tadalafil to effectively assist with erectile dysfunction, it’s important to note that sexual arousal is a necessary stimulus for the medication to work properly.
Special considerations for 20mg dosage
If prescribed a 20mg dose for erectile dysfunction, it is typically due to previous experiences where the 10mg dose was deemed insufficient. Always ensure that you take the medication at least 30 minutes prior to the intended sexual activity for optimal results.
If you forget to take it
If you happen to mi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it's nearly time for your next scheduled dose, skip the missed dose and return to your regular dosing routine.
Do not double up on doses to compensate for a missed one, as this could increase your risk of side effects. If you find that forgetting doses is a frequent occurrence, consider setting reminders on your phone or using a pill organizer.
If you take too much
Taking an excessive amount of tadalafil can lead to a range of side effects including:
- Headache
- Dizziness
- Indigestion
- Stuffy nose
- Changes in vision, including blurred or altered vision
Urgent advice: Contact a healthcare professional immediately if:
- You suspect you have taken more than your prescribed dose of tadalafil.

General advice on tadalafil usage
It is crucial to inform your doctor of any other medications you are using to prevent potential interactions. Additionally, avoid consuming grapefruit or grapefruit juice, as it can significantly affect the metabolism of tadalafil, potentially leading to increased side effects.
Store tadalafil in a cool, dry location, away from direct sunlight and out of reach of children. Following storage instructions will ensure the medication remains effective and safe for use.
